The inn was built in 1636 from reclaimed shipping timbers meaning some parts of the construction could be over 1000-years-old.

Located on Watling Street, the building has been used as a coachman's inn and stop-over for travellers for nearly four centuries. During that time it has seen a number of grisly deaths.

Eerie encounters suggest not all of its guests have checked out.

The apparition of a Roundhead soldier has been seen in the gents toilets and the spirits of two children, perhaps brother and sister, have been seen playing in a hallway.

It is reported guests have fled the pub rather than spend the night after encountering strange noises, smashing glasses and even the uttering of an invisible voice.
